B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and analyzed to satisfy stringent quality and protection criteria. BHT is often a lipophilic natural compound that is generally employed as an antioxidant in many industrial applications. In animal nutrition, BHT FEED GRADE TEST is greatly applied to stop the oxidation of fats and oils in animal feed, therefore preserving the nutritional benefit and extending the shelf lifetime of the feed. Oxidized fats not simply lose nutritional efficacy but could also create hazardous compounds, affecting the wellness and advancement of livestock. The inclusion of BHT in feed necessitates demanding tests to be sure it adheres to regulatory benchmarks and is also Harmless for use by animals, which inevitably enters the human foods chain. The testing protocols usually evaluate the purity, efficacy, and possible residues in animal tissues.

M-Phenylene Diamine, generally abbreviated as MPD, is an aromatic amine that features prominently while in the production of aramid fibers, that happen to be properly-recognized for their heat resistance and power. Kevlar and Nomex, used in system armor and fireplace-resistant garments, respectively, are manufactured utilizing MPD as being a critical precursor. The compound itself is made of a benzene ring with two amino teams within the meta positions, which makes it suitable for generating polymers with attractive thermal and mechanical Qualities. M-Phenylene Diamine (MPD) can be Utilized in the dye sector, notably in hair dyes along with other beauty programs, although its use has become curtailed in some locations due to protection problems. When production items containing MPD, right occupational basic safety methods are necessary to safeguard workers from prolonged publicity, which may lead to pores and skin sensitization or other health problems.

Pinacolone is another noteworthy compound with a range of applications. This is a ketone with the molecular formulation C6H12O and is particularly made use of mostly being an intermediate from the synthesis of pesticides and herbicides, specifically from the creation of triazole fungicides and selected plant expansion regulators. Pinacolone’s composition includes a tertiary butyl group, which contributes to its exclusive reactivity in natural and organic synthesis. Beyond agriculture, it may also be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its capability to endure nucleophilic substitution and condensation reactions, rendering it a worthwhile reagent in laboratory and industrial processes. Though it's considerably less dangerous than a number of the Formerly talked about compounds, basic safety safeguards remain essential to mitigate any hazards affiliated with its volatility and possible irritant Homes.

two-Heptanone is usually a ketone that By natural means happens in a few vegetation and is likewise located in small quantities in human sweat and specific animal secretions. It is often Utilized in the fragrance and flavor industries as a consequence of its enjoyable, fruity odor. In addition, 2-Heptanone has identified programs being a solvent and intermediate in natural and organic synthesis. Apparently, study has prompt that it may Engage in a task in chemical signaling, particularly in insects, the place it functions being an alarm pheromone. This has brought about its analyze in pest control strategies and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its comparatively very low toxicity makes it well suited for use in buyer merchandise, Whilst correct labeling and managing Directions are generally mandated.
